This print showcases the "Darmstadt Madonna, with portraits of donors" by an unknown artist from the 19th century. The original artwork, created by Hans Holbein the Younger in 1525-26 and 1528, is a masterpiece of oil and tempera on lime wood. This digitally restored reproduction captures every intricate detail of the painting. The focal point of this composition is undoubtedly the serene image of the Madonna herself. With her gentle gaze and graceful demeanor, she exudes a sense of divine peace and maternal love. Surrounding her are portraits of generous donors who have contributed to this sacred piece. The rich colors and meticulous brushwork bring life to each face depicted in this religious tableau. It serves as a testament to both Christian faith and artistic skill during the Renaissance period. Displayed on a Holbein carpet, which adds further depth and texture to the scene, this artwork becomes more than just a religious icon; it becomes an embodiment of devotion itself.
